Tree shadow

Its amazing what you notice once the image is scanned and appears on the screen. This again has been cropped, a lot, and flipped horizontally. Don't know why flipping it improves it, maybe because we read left to right, would other cultures judge the flip differently? Maybe I shouldn't try to explain what I was trying to do, it reduces it all to a recipe, its the taste I want to convey.
Well its a sort of bored Sunday afternoon thing, living next to a road where, nothing ever happens and you are prepared to look for meaning in anything, even a car that drives past and the sound fades slowly to nothing. Sounds really boring put like that, but I think there is a kind of intensity to extreme non events.................time for my medication.
